This painting is a field of shifting gold, its surface alive with brush marks and ridges that catch the light differently with each glance. What appears at first as a single tone reveals layers of touch, a record of its making. The gold radiates yet remains imperfect, carrying the evidence of human presence. In that texture, a sense of belonging takes shape—marks gathered into a shared field, reminding us that connection is built through traces and gestures held together over time.
